Output 2569289103a40f8a79c3aa853d3dfe02a039580ea50ef467cf18121170c9fe69:1

value
2519546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ebba035a04619897cbde78c8bcbca68b872081c OP_EQUAL
address
3DF7qBfsNEJmK8SWPCrTJs29FMt3vcVzkH
transaction
2569289103a40f8a79c3aa853d3dfe02a039580ea50ef467cf18121170c9fe69
spent
true